Create Source-Rich Content

Embed clickable citations, reference authoritative studies, and link to primary sources throughout your content. When making claims, immediately follow with supporting evidence. For example, instead of stating "Most businesses see ROI improvements," write "According to McKinsey's 2026 digital transformation study, 73% of businesses implementing AI solutions report 15-25% ROI improvements within 12 months."

Develop Content Depth Matrices

For each topic cluster, create comprehensive content that addresses beginner, intermediate, and expert-level questions. Use internal linking to connect related concepts, demonstrating topical authority. Build FAQ sections that anticipate follow-up questions AI systems commonly generate.

Establish Cross-Platform Consistency

Ensure your key messages, data points, and expertise claims remain consistent across your website, social media, press releases, and third-party publications. Inconsistent information across platforms significantly damages confidence scores.

Optimize for Entity Recognition

Use clear, consistent terminology for industry concepts, product names, and key entities. Create glossaries and definition sections that help AI models understand your domain expertise. When introducing technical terms, provide brief explanations that establish context.

Build Author Authority Signals

Create detailed author bio pages with credentials, publications, and expertise areas. Link author profiles to their content and maintain updated professional information. For B2B content, include company leadership bios and team expertise sections.

Implement Freshness Indicators

Add visible publication and update dates to content. Create editorial calendars that ensure regular content updates, particularly for rapidly evolving topics. Use "last reviewed" dates for evergreen content to signal ongoing accuracy verification.

Monitor Confidence Metrics

Track how often your content appears in AI-generated responses using tools like BrightEdge or similar AI search monitoring platforms. Analyze which content pieces receive highest citation rates and reverse-engineer successful confidence signals.
